On a factorized L-fuzzy automaton and its L-fuzzy topological characterization
Fuzzy Sets and Systems ( IF 3.9 ) Pub Date : 2020-07-22 , DOI: 10.1016/j.fss.2020.07.014
Shailendra Singh , S.P. Tiwari , Priyanka Pal

This paper is towards the study of L-fuzzy automata via theory of factorizations, where L is a complete residuated lattice. We study the concept of factorization of L-fuzzy sets and factorization of collection of L-fuzzy sets. Such factorizations are used (i) to study the concept of minimal L-fuzzy automaton, and (ii) to introduce L-fuzzy topologies for the study of concepts associated with an L-fuzzy automaton. Specifically, we introduce the notion of factorized L-fuzzy automaton corresponding to a given L-fuzzy automaton and study the minimality of such automaton. Further, we associate L-fuzzy topologies for factorized L-fuzzy automaton and use these to characterize some algebraic concepts.
